South Africa - Import of Sets of Hand Tools

Since 2014, South Africa Import of Sets of Hand Tools fell by 2.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 53 comparing other countries in Import of Sets of Hand Tools at $1,307,508.54. South Africa is overtaken by Greece, which was number 52 at $1,345,643.63 and is followed by Bahrain at $1,166,982.35. Thailand lead the ranking with $198,849,931.93 in 2019, a growth of 285% versus 2018. France, Saudi Arabia and China resp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Guyana witnessed the best average annual growth at +128.1% per year, while Central African Republic witnessed the worst performance at -64.4% per year.
